ABSTRACT:
A frequency generating circuit scales a warp range of a frequency signal. The frequency generating circuit includes a first frequency signal (10) having a first offset signal with a first frequency relationship to the first frequency signal, and a second frequency signal (14). A frequency scaling element (16) receives the first frequency signal (10) and second frequency signal and provides a third frequency signal, such that the third frequency signal includes the first offset signal having a second frequency relationship to the third signal. A switch (54), has a control input (74), a first input for receiving the first frequency signal, a second input operably coupled to the frequency scaling element (16, 42) for receiving the third frequency signal and an output (76) operably coupled to the first input or the second input dependent upon a control signal applied to the control input (74).
